On Sunday in Tokyo, External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ar and US Secretary of State Antony Blinken discussed bilateral relations and global issues. The meeting was held during the Quad foreign ministers’ gathering. The Quad, comprising India, Japan, the US, and Australia, seeks to secure the Indo-Pacific sea routes amid disputes in the South China Sea.
